Fly to Krakow Airport, 20km from Wieliczka. Direct trains from Krakow to Wieliczka take 20 minutes. By car, it's a 30-minute drive from Krakow. For domestic travellers, direct trains from Warsaw take 3 hours.
The most convenient airport for Wieliczka, Poland is Krakow Airport (KRK). It's ideal due to its proximity, being approximately 25km away, and offers numerous domestic and international flights.
Wieliczka, Poland, offers various public transport options. The town is served by bus lines 304 and 904 from Krakow. For local travel, consider the mini-bus services. Alternatively, the compact town centre is easily navigable on foot or by bicycle. If you prefer driving, car hire services are available.
The best area to stay in Wieliczka, Poland, is the city centre, known for its proximity to the famous Wieliczka Salt Mine, a UNESCO World Heritage Site. It offers convenient access to restaurants, shops, and public transport.

Went specifically to see the salt mine.
Went specifically to see the salt mine. I wish I had researched a bit more and did the hands on miners tour and not the walk through tour. Upon finishing the tour, you have to walk about 800m through a corridor to get to the lift. Upon reaching the surface you end up about 600m from the salt mine entry point, google maps is really helpful as there isn’t much direction from the tour guides on completion of the tour once you reach the surface. “Kuchnia Smaku” does a decent feed too. We also stayed in Wieliczka and caught the train to Krakow, which was really cheap and took us straight into Krakow town centre. From there it is a short walk to the town centre and to Wawel castle (closed Monday’s). The basilica was fantastic and I highly recommend the audio tour (an extra 7pln and a 100pln deposit for the unit which you get back when you return the audio device). At Krakow main station, it’s really confusing and you have to buy tickets from an actual person from a ticket desk, I didn’t see any self help ticket machines. The ticket machine at the Wieliczka train station was also complicated as it offered options for about 6 different train lines, we just chose the first option, and there is no option to use money, just PayPass/credit card on those machines either.
